Warning Signs You Need Warehouse Water Damage Restoration

Catching water damage early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:

Peeling Paint or Discoloration

If you notice peeling paint or discoloration on your walls or ceilings, it may be a sign of hidden water damage. This can be a sign of a leaky roof, faulty pipes, or a clogged drain.

Musty Odors

Strong musty odors can be a sign of hidden moisture or mold growth. If you notice a persistent musty smell in your warehouse, it’s essential to investigate further.

Warped or Buckled Floors

Warped or buckled floors can be a sign of water damage or structural issues. If you notice any changes in your flooring, it’s crucial to address the issue quickly.

Water Stains or Mineral Deposits

Water stains or mineral deposits on your walls or ceilings can be a sign of water damage or mineral buildup. This can be caused by a leaky pipe, clogged drain, or poor ventilation.

Mold Growth

Mold growth is a clear sign of hidden moisture or water damage. If you notice any mold growth in your warehouse,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age and health risks.

Unusual Sounds or Leaks

Unusual sounds or leaks in your warehouse can be a sign of water damage or structural issues. If you notice any unusual sounds or leaks, it’s crucial to investigate further.

Warehouse Water Damage Restoration Cost in Luther, OK

The cost of warehouse water damage restoration in Luther, OK, can vary a lot depending on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ide you with a detailed estimate based on an on-site assessment. Here are some estimated costs to expect: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and travel time.
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and travel time.
Cleaning and Disinfection $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of cleaning products used, and travel time.
Final Inspection and Testing $100 – $500 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and travel time.

Keep in mind that these are estimated costs, and the final price will depend on an on-site assessment and the specifics of your situation.
